Where the Clubhouse sits and why that matters

Virgin Atlantic operates from Heathrow Terminal 3. The Clubhouse lives airside, one level up from the major departures concourse, near Gate 13. You clear protection first, then apply the signage for lounges. This things due to the fact that get right of entry to principles tie lower back to the airline you're flying, your cabin, and on occasion the alliance companion that issued your price tag. If you're flying out of any other terminal, the Clubhouse will never be out there. There isn't any inter-terminal airside link that will will let you jump over only for a drink. Departing from Terminal 5 with a codeshare on BA does not lend a hand. You want a identical-day, departing flight from T3 on Virgin Atlantic or a qualifying spouse.

Who gets in via perfect of cabin

The only direction is a business class seat. If you are travelling in Virgin Atlantic Upper Class, you've gotten complimentary get entry to to the Heathrow Virgin Lounge on the day you fly. That is properly whether your price tag is paid or an award, whether you booked direct or by the use of a shuttle agent. Upper Class is Virgin’s long-haul “virgin atlantic company type,” and it unlocks the total Clubhouse experience: à la carte dining, the sizeable bar, showers on request, and mostly a relaxed pocket of the terminal even if the rest of T3 heaves.

Flying Premium, which sits among economy and Upper Class, does no longer grant front room get admission to by way of default. Premium brings priority payment-in and further legroom, however now not the Clubhouse. Economy Light, Classic, and Delight additionally do not comprise living room get right of entry to.

There is one aspect case to look at. Occasionally, in the time of irregular operations or whilst the living room is at potential, access for exact eligible passengers might possibly be waitlisted. That most frequently impacts prestige-established get right of entry to other than Upper Class shoppers. If you are in Upper Class, you're broadly speaking waved with the aid of.

Status-structured get entry to: Virgin Atlantic Flying Club

Virgin Atlantic’s possess standing tiers nevertheless lift weight at the Clubhouse door, nevertheless the laws depend upon cabin and even if your flight is fairly on Virgin metallic.

    Flying Club Gold: If you carry Gold and you're flying the same day on a Virgin Atlantic-operated flight from Heathrow, you've got Clubhouse get admission to even while you are in Premium or Economy. You would invite one guest, provided that they are additionally flying on the comparable Virgin Atlantic flight. I even have considered personnel take a look at that the visitor’s call and flight fit yours before printing visitor passes. If your flight is on a spouse from T3, get entry to can vary; traditionally a few companion-operated departures were diagnosed, but the most secure route is a Virgin-operated boarding pass. Flying Club Silver: Silver does not furnish Clubhouse entry via itself. If you might be in Premium or Economy with Silver, you possibly can now not get in devoid of every other qualifying factor, which includes a day go by using a credit score card perk or a individual merchandising.

Virgin occasionally runs restricted-time affords that enlarge Clubhouse access to positive participants, distinctly throughout shoulder seasons. These are actual however now not predictable satisfactory to plan round.

What approximately Priority Pass, paid entry, or credits cards?

If you might be coming from the world of lounge memberships, the Clubhouse feels historical-school. Priority Pass, LoungeKey, DragonPass, and related systems do no longer unlock the Heathrow Virgin Lounge. There isn't any walk-up paid access for the general public. Virgin has infrequently supplied paid get entry to to settle upon users thru email in quieter classes, however it isn't always a printed product and is additionally pulled with no detect.

Premium credit playing cards are similar. A Platinum card with living room merits can get you into the Plaza Premium Lounge or the Amex Centurion Lounge in T3, yet not the Clubhouse. Even the Virgin Atlantic Reward+ credit card inside the UK does no longer embrace assured Clubhouse access: it allows you earn accomplice vouchers and improvements, which might cross you into Upper Class, but it does now not act like a living room pass on its possess.

How to qualify while you do no longer already

If you are in Premium or Economy and would like the Clubhouse ride, you have three simple paths.

    Fly Upper Class. The elementary approach. Look for off-peak dates on routes like Boston, New York, or the Caribbean, the place sale fares commonly dip to the low four figures from London. If you'll commute Tuesday or Wednesday, expenses soften. Booking early and heading off faculty holidays supports. Use aspects and enhancements. Virgin Atlantic Flying Club miles should be would becould very well be distinctly mighty on off-height calendars. A one-method Upper Class award between London and the East Coast frequently falls inside the 47,500 to sixty seven,500 miles quantity off-peak, 77,500 to ninety five,000 height, plus expenditures. If you've a Premium coins ticket, improvements to Upper Class require availability inside the “G” fare bucket and a bit of miles, in most cases 18,000 to 35,000 for a one-way upgrade depending on direction and season, plus a fare change if your fashioned price tag used to be not in an upgradable fare classification. Companion vouchers from the Virgin Atlantic Reward or Reward+ credits playing cards in the UK can double the worth on off-peak dates. Availability movements straight away while a sale drops, so set signals and act instant. Earn or leverage reputation. If you fly Virgin ample to push for Gold, the Clubhouse will become a predictable perk, even on non-Upper Class itineraries. Gold requires 1,000 Tier Points in a rolling 12 months. As a rule of thumb, a around-journey in Upper Class more often than not earns two hundred to 400 Tier Points relying on fare class and course, at the same time as Premium circular-journeys would earn a hundred to 200. Two or three transatlantic Upper Class around-trips can tick you over. For many guests, features and enhancements are a speedier course than chasing fame from scratch.

Arrivals lounge and connections

Landing at Heathrow and hoping for a shower in the Clubhouse is a general ask. The Clubhouse is a departures living room in simple terms. Years ago, Virgin operated a separate arrivals living room landside, but that facility closed and has no longer back. If you might be connecting equal-day from a Virgin Atlantic lengthy-haul into a further Virgin or spouse departure from T3, you are able to use the Clubhouse for the period of the relationship, offered your onward boarding flow qualifies. Keep your time buffer straightforward. Heathrow connections chunk up minutes with safety and going for walks. If your connection is beneath 90 minutes, the front room give up possibly extra tension than it's price.
